Specifications include, but are not limited to: 1.HIGH DENSITY POLYETHYLENE (HDPE): Solid Walled, Smooth Lined Pipe & Fittings shall conform to the requirements of AASHTO M326. Pipe shall be solid walled and shall have smooth wall interior and smooth exterior. Pipe supplied shall be manufactured only by companies that have been preapproved and arelisted on the VDOT Materials Division list for HIGH DENSITY POLYETHYLENE (HDPE) PIPEPRODUCERS- (QUALITY ASSURANCE). All pipes shall be manufactured by a VDOT approved manufacturer. In order to be considered responsive to this bid, the manufacturer that provides the Pipe must be a participant in the VDOT Quality Assurance/Quality Control Program (QA/QC).‐see Attachment G.3.Pipes shall be capable of being joined into a continuous length by an interlocking method.:The joints shall not create an increase in the outside diameter of the pipe. The joints must be water-tight with gaskets that are capable of handling pressures up to 25 feet of head pressure meeting the watertight requirements of ASTM D3212 (laboratory pressure tested at 10.8 psi). Gaskets shall be installed by the pipe manufacturer and covered with a removal, protective wrap to ensure the gaskets are free from debris.4.Joint lubricant:Shall be used on the gasket and bell during assembly, and included in the shipment of pipe from the manufacturer, cost shall be inclusive of the linear feet of pipe.
